How a $0.73 Stamp Exposed a Fake Shin-Etsu Logo

The package arrived on a Tuesday. Inside a flimsy gray envelope: a ziplock bag of silicone finger cots, a one-page “Certificate of Authenticity,” and a product sheet with a Shin-Etsu logo printed at the top.

My cleanroom supervisor picked up the bag and turned it over. “Looks right,” she said. “Same blue packaging. Same brand. And 25% less than what we’re paying now.”

She wasn’t wrong about the price. That was the problem.

When Our Silicone Supplier Raised Prices 22%

Two weeks earlier, our long-time supplier—an authorized Shin-Etsu distributor—announced a 22% price increase across their silicone line. Our annual spend on finger cots alone was $3,600. The hike pushed it to $4,392. On a product that hadn’t changed in five years.

Some background on me: I’m the procurement manager at a mid-sized electronics manufacturer, about 200 employees. I’ve managed our raw materials budget for six years, tracked every order in our cost system, and negotiated with more vendors than I can count. Total materials spend: roughly $180,000 a year. When one line item jumps 22%, that’s not a number I just accept.

Shin-Etsu (people often type “shin etsu” when searching) is one of the largest silicone manufacturers in the world. They don’t sell direct—they sell through authorized distributors. So when our distributor raised prices, I had two choices: accept it, or find a better-priced authorized source.

I pulled quotes from three vendors.

The first was another authorized Shin-Etsu distributor. Responsive, professional, and priced about the same as our current supplier. The second was a plastics company we’d used years ago for custom HDPE parts: HDPE Inc. The third was a listing on an online marketplace with no phone number, no address, and zero reviews—instant no.

HDPE Inc. had expanded into silicone components. Their quote undercut our current supplier by exactly 25%. Free priority shipping on bulk orders. Certificate of Analysis on every batch, they promised. Their sales rep called three times in one week.

Twenty-five percent cheaper. It got my attention.

The Spreadsheet Said Switch. My Gut Said Wait.

I went back and forth between the authorized distributor and HDPE Inc. for two weeks. The distributor offered reliability and real traceability, but the price was painful. HDPE Inc. offered $900 a year in savings on finger cots alone—money I could move to other material lines that were also creeping up.

I ran the numbers in a TCO spreadsheet. Every cost analysis pointed to HDPE Inc. But something felt off.

Maybe it was the sales pitch. Every question I asked got the same canned answer: “We supply genuine Shin-Etsu materials, fully certified, with full traceability.” But when I asked for a sample, there was a pause. A long one.

The sample finally arrived in that gray envelope. It had a $0.73 USPS First-Class stamp on it—the standard letter rate, per USPS, as of January 2025. One stamp. That’s how a “certified cleanroom supplier” shipped a validation sample. Here’s what I mean: a real distributor sends samples in sealed packaging with lot labels and a pouch for the CoA. This looked like a birthday card.

Not ideal, but workable, I told myself. Then I looked at the logo again.

The Shin-Etsu Logo That Didn’t Match

The Shin-Etsu logo is a clean, confident mark. The blue is deep and saturated. The letter spacing is tight. The registered trademark symbol is tiny, almost easy to miss.

The logo on HDPE Inc.’s packaging was... almost that. I pulled up Shin-Etsu’s official website and held my phone next to the box. The differences started to show:

  • Color. The official Shin-Etsu blue is approximately Pantone 286 C. The packaging blue was washed out, like a CMYK conversion that had been photocopied a few times. Industry tolerance for brand colors is Delta E < 2—this was way beyond that.
  • Print quality. A legitimate commercial logo is printed at 300 DPI or higher at final size. The edges of this logo were soft and pixelated, especially around the letters. It looked scanned, not printed from original artwork.
  • Details. The ® symbol was oversized. In the real logo, it’s tiny. HDPE Inc.’s designers knew the symbol mattered but didn’t know why.

Counterfeit packaging is rarely perfect. It’s almost-right. The same washed-out blue and blurry edges appeared on HDPE Inc.’s quote and product sheet.

The product sheet also said: “100% food-grade silicone, biodegradable, eco-friendly.” Those are big claims. Per FTC guidelines, environmental claims like “biodegradable” need evidence—the FTC Green Guides are pretty clear about that. And silicone doesn’t biodegrade in any practical timeframe. So either HDPE Inc. wasn’t selling real silicone, or they were putting buzzwords on paper and hoping nobody asked.

Neither option belongs in a cleanroom.

On Monday, I emailed Shin-Etsu’s Americas office. Subject line: “Authorized distributor verification request.” I attached HDPE Inc.’s quote and photos of the sample packaging.

The reply came the next business day. HDPE Inc. was not—and had never been—an authorized Shin-Etsu distributor. They had never purchased from Shin-Etsu. The logo, the packaging, and the certificate were unverified, Shin-Etsu confirmed.

They also pointed me to the authorized distributor list on their website. The distributor I’d been comparing against was on it. HDPE Inc. was not.

I still kick myself for not checking that list earlier. It’s public, it takes two minutes, and it would have saved me two weeks of spreadsheet debates.

The TCO That Won the Argument

Let’s put the final numbers on the table, because the surface math is what almost got us.

HDPE Inc. quote: $2,700 per year. Authorized distributor quote: $3,600 per year. Difference: $900.

But total cost of ownership isn’t a price tag. Here’s the full picture:

  • Shipping. HDPE Inc. promised free priority shipping, then mailed the sample with a $0.73 stamp. If that’s how they handle a sample, imagine a bulk order.
  • Documentation. Their “Certificate of Authenticity” was printed on 20 lb copy paper with no lot number, no lab reference, and no signature. It was a prop. A real CoA traces every batch to a Shin-Etsu production lot.
  • Risk. In 2023, a contamination incident in our line cost us $8,400 in rework—scrapped components, lost labor, a delayed shipment. If counterfeit finger cots had shed particles onto circuit boards, the rework bill would have dwarfed the $900 we thought we were saving.
  • Support. The authorized distributor’s engineers answer technical questions within hours. HDPE Inc.’s sales rep stopped returning calls the moment I asked for distributor certification.

The math was never close. $900 in savings against $8,400 of potential rework—plus the softer costs: lost production time, a delayed customer shipment, and a procurement team that loses credibility with the factory floor. The “cheap” option was expensive in every direction that mattered.

Where did we land? We stayed with our original distributor. The 22% hike was real, but we negotiated it down to 9% by committing to a two-year volume agreement. It wasn’t the $900 “savings” HDPE Inc. offered, but it was real, documented, and traceable.

How We Vet Suppliers Now

After this, I built a vendor vetting checklist and put it in a shared spreadsheet. Now it takes about 30 minutes to validate any supplier claiming to carry Shin-Etsu products:

  1. Check the authorized distributor list on the Shin-Etsu website. Not listed? Ask for written confirmation of their sourcing status.
  2. Compare the logo against official brand assets. Check the color and the print sharpness. A blurry logo is a red flag.
  3. Request a Certificate of Analysis with a lot number, and verify it where possible.
  4. Order a small sample before committing. Notice how it’s shipped, packed, and labeled.
  5. Run the TCO calculator—including shipping, documentation, risk, and support—not just the quote.

The checklist did more than catch problems. It made us faster. Our vendor vetting turnaround dropped from five days to about two. We stopped chasing dead ends. And in the months since, it’s already flagged a suspicious quote on another material line.

That’s the part nobody puts in a proposal: the efficiency of knowing what you’re buying. When the process works, it’s almost boring. And boring is fine by me.

Here’s what I’d tell any buyer sourcing silicone components: the Shin-Etsu logo is one of the most respected marks in this industry, which is exactly why it gets faked. Checking that logo isn’t paranoia—it’s the fastest due diligence shortcut you have.
